Use the notification URL
We recommend using the notification URL. This URL is to be provided in the "doWebPayment" web service as an entry in the "<notificationURL>" tag.
The notification URL allows you to be informed of the completion of a payment attempt on your pages to be able to fetch the result of the transaction by calling the "getWebPaymentDetails" web service.
In case the automatic return to the shop did not work, the notification alerts you so that you can pick up the result of the transaction.
Return URL
The url of return is the url back to the shop at the end of the web transaction. Do not confuse with the acceptance URL.
Cancel URL
The cancel url is a return url to the shop when the buyer, once arrived on the payment page, changes his mind and clicks the cancel button before having entered his card number.

Web service : doWebPayment
The doWebPayment function allows you to initialize a web payment transaction before redirecting your customer to the Payline payment pages. It allows to make cash payments, immediate or deferred, payments in Nfois or by subscription
To be informed of your customer's payment once the authorization request has been accepted and even if it does not return to your site by itself, you must enter the "notificationURL" field on your point of sale configuration or when your request to initialize a web payment. Payline contacts a page of your site and sends you the payment token as a GET parameter of the HTTP request. This page must be accessible over the Internet using the HTTP / S protocol.
Upon receipt of a notification, your site must make a request for result of the notified web payment.
If your site is not reachable, Payline makes an attempt every minute for 2 hours. After this time, notification of this payment is disabled. You will find your payments in the web interface of the Merchant Administration Center.

for example: For a doWebPayment, the notification type is WEBTRS and the web service to call is getWebPayment detail to get the result of the web transaction. In this case, the complete notification URL will be:
http: // URL_DE_NOTIFICATION NOTIFICATIONTYPE = webtrs & token = TOKEN_LORS_DU_DOWEBPAYMENT?
